Kunějovice was formerly part of the German Empire. In the German Empire, the place was called Kuniowitz.
The place is now called Kunějovice and belongs to Czech Republic.
| Historical place name | Country | Administration | Time |
|---|---|---|---|
| Kuniowitz | Austro-Hungary | Mies | before the Treaty of Saint-Germain |
| Kunějovice | Austro-Hungary | Mies | before the Treaty of Saint-Germain |
| Kunějovice | Czechoslovakia | Stříbro | after the Treaty of Saint-Germain |
| Kuniowitz | Czechoslovakia | Stříbro | after the Treaty of Saint-Germain |
| Kuniowitz | German Empire | Mies | 1938 |
| Kunějovice | Czechoslovakia | Plzeň | 1945 |
| Kunějovice | Czechoslovakia | Plzeň-sever | 1992 |
| Kunějovice | Czech Republic | Plzeň-sever | 1993 |
